Meurisse Chocolate NV is the oldest chocolate maker in Belgium, founded in 1845 and relaunched in 2020 with sustainability as a central part of the business. The company is based in Antwerp, Belgium, and became a Certified B Corporation in April 2024 with a B Impact Score of 97.5. Publicly available information describes work on ethical sourcing, organic and Fairtrade certifications, and packaging changes. Meurisse says it works exclusively with Cacao-Trace and aims to make responsibly sourced products with a positive impact, while keeping claims transparent and based on factual numbers.

Meurisse Chocolate NV Sustainability Commitments
2025
Certification by 2025
By 2025 at the latest, all the chocolate produced and/or sold in Belgium shall comply with a relevant certification standards and/or shall be manufactured from cocoa-based products covered by a corporate sustainability scheme.
2025
End deforestation by 2025
By 2025 at the latest deforestation due to cocoa growing for the Belgian chocolate sector has ended.
2030
Living income by 2030
By 2030 at the latest, cocoa growers will earn at least a living income.
